Who should choose which?
Choose
Danelfin if…
- You need ai score (1–10) estimates the probability of a stock or etf outperforming the market over the next three months, based on daily analysis of ~10,000 features per stock across technical, fundamental, and sentiment data.
- You need coverage includes u.s.-listed stocks and etfs as well as stoxx 600 european stocks, with historical daily ai scores available since 2017.
- You need rest api with api key authentication and json output. endpoints include rankings, filters (date, ticker, sector, industry, asset type), buy/sell track record filters, and sector/industry breakdowns.
- You need api plans (basic, expert, elite) differ by monthly call quotas and rate limits - current annual pricing shows 1,000, 10,000, and 100,000 calls per month with 120, 240, and 1,200 calls/minute respectively.
Choose
FinancialReports.eu if…
- You need real-time data, not delayed quotes
- You need real-time filings ingestion (<5 min typical) across 44 european markets; public api page now lists 33,501 companies and 15,414,728 historical filings.
- You need programmatic access to filings, company metadata, languages, countries, filing types, sources; markdown extraction endpoint for filing text.
- You need api docs include a 2026 changelog with mcp connector write operations and beta ai rag agent api endpoints for programmatic interaction with the ai assistant.
